2009-03-09 12 views
2

私は何百万もの行を持つテーブルを持っています。Where句の小さなIDセットによるフィルタリングのパフォーマンスへの影響

1〜1000の一意の値(ほとんどの状況ではおそらく30未満)を保持するInteger列(インデックス付き)を追加したいとします。

私のクエリは次のようになり場合はウィルのクエリのパフォーマンスが実質的に低下する:グループID IN(1、123、20、30、40)

+0

何に比べて? – Richard

答えて

3

があなたのテーブルに持っていることを確認したMyTable FROM

SELECT * GroupIDのインデックス。

そうでなければ、それはうまくいくはずです - これはデータベースのためのものです。

関連する問題